As for today being National French Fry Day, celebrating Hump Day with one of America’s favorite foods couldn’t be any better. The origin of the holiday is not really known, just like the origin of the name of the popular food. Some have claimed that the name came from Belgium, but most claims say that the name did not come from France. The French part of the name supposedly was attached because the Belgian troops spoke French during WWI, which was when the Belgian fries were discovered, so people then started calling them “french fries.”
